It's a One Piece fanfic called Boy With a Scar (Link HERE or HERE), and it's based on the idea that if Luffy had been enslaved by the celestial dragons as a child and made to fight in arena death matches before escaping and setting out on his journey to become pirate king, how would his character and the story have changed? I'm absolutely infatuated with this darker version of Luffy where he's not only so much stronger, but much more ruthless and jaded, and yet somehow manages to maintain his silly, childish side. I also think his dream of becoming Pirate King has a much more solidified reason from the very start - after all, it makes sense that a former slave would dream of becoming the freest person in the world!
